Auctria offers two main paths for connecting your event to outside tools and data. Which one you need depends on what you're trying to do:
- Moving a batch of data in or out of Auctria (like a spreadsheet of bidders)? See Import/Export.
- Sending a real-time notification the moment something happens in Auctria (like a sale)? See Automations.
You can also use both together — for example, importing your donor list at the start of an event, and using Automations to notify staff of activity throughout the event.
Which One Do I Need?
| If you want to... | Use... |
|---|---|
| Upload a spreadsheet of participants, items, or donors | Import/Export |
| Update existing records in bulk from a file | Import/Export |
| Export event data to Excel for reporting | Import/Export |
| Get a Slack or email alert when a sale happens | Automations |
| Notify staff in real time about specific transaction types | Automations |
| Connect Auctria to Slack, Gmail, or Google Calendar | Automations |
Import/Export
Import/Export handles bulk, on-demand data transfer between Auctria and a spreadsheet or Google Sheet. Use it when you need to:
- Bring in a list of participants, items, donors, or expenses from an existing spreadsheet
- Update existing records in bulk (for example, correcting paddle numbers or item details)
- Pull data out of Auctria as an Excel file for reporting, mailing, or use in another system
Good to Know
Import/Export moves data in discrete batches that you trigger yourself — it doesn't run automatically or in real time. If you need Auctria to notify another tool the instant something happens, see Automations below instead.

Automations
Automations is a lightweight, real-time notification layer built on Zapier. Use it when you need to:
- Notify a Slack channel or send an email the moment a sale or registration happens
- Connect Auctria events (sales, registrations, item activity, transactions) to tools like Slack, Gmail, or Google Calendar
- Filter notifications down to specific conditions (like only sponsorship-level sales)
Good to Know
Automations is not a full CRM integration or a way to move historical or bulk data — it's built for ongoing, event-triggered notifications going forward. If you need to move existing records in bulk, use Import/Export above instead.
